A theme is more productive than setting formats manually and it provides consistency across all your files. It, by virtue of your choices, defines the color, font, background style and effects. What’s a theme?Ī theme is a combination of formats that create an entire look for your Microsoft 365 files. In the Variants group you’ll see other two options which allow you to modify the font of the presentation or the effects applied to the resources.If you change the background using the Format Background options, all your background pictures will be removed. To apply a custom background, click Apply to All. If you choose to do it via Format Background, its panel will appear on the right side of the screen. You can choose any of the presets or click Format Background, where you’ll be able to use solid colors, gradients, images or patterns as background. To change the color of the background, click the Variants drop-down arrow and click Background Styles. ![]() You can see a little preview in the top-right corner of this window. A new window will open, where you can select the colors that best suit your needs. If you want to apply a specific palette to the presentation, click Customize Colors.
